So in the past few weeks we've had a few vet visits with Ginger (that turned one years old a few weeks ago). She developed pretty severe diarrhea. As in explosive diarrhea (my poor son was sitting behind her when it started and got completely sprayed!). Pumpkin, rice and boiled chicken did nothing to touch it. Also out of no where her ears just looked awful.
So off to the vet we went. She had a week of two different antibiotics, as well as antibiotics that go in her ears. This cleared up the diarrhea very quickly thankfully, and at a recheck today her ears looked much better as well. But the vet feels that it is all allergy related. She said her skin is looking pink, maybe a bit inflamed. She told me to start giving her benadryl two-three times a day.
I'm looking to see if maybe a better food might help her as well. We've been feeding her Nature's Domain from Costco (Turkey and Sweet Potato, grain free) for months with no problems until now. But come to think of it, I do have to give her pumpkin regularly as her stool does get soft. So maybe that was my early clue that it wasn't agreeing with her.
Any advice on what foods might be best for a bully with allergies? Any advice would be much appreciative!! Thank you!
